Compounds with extremely branched molecular structures (for example 1) that are formed in iterative syntheses are penetrating many disciplines of chemistry. Compound 1 has 36 carboxyl groups on its periphery and can be considered a unimolecular micelle. Recently dendrimers have found their way into coordination chemistry through a compound which contains up to 22 metal centers per molecule (see also Balzani et al. Angew. Chem. Int. Ed. Engl. 1992, 31, 1493).
